与混乱前者确保密文与明文在形式联系上有足够的差异,后者则使明文中的任何微小变化都被扩散到密文的各个部分,从而尽量降低统计的规律性。01:8则充分使用了混乱和扩散技术,从而确保了较高的安全性。
(⑴政务知识023加密系统演示。
图6-14是笔者设计开发的政务知识028加密系统 该系统能够实现对各种格式文件的01:3加密与解密,并且具有较高的运行效率。在政务管理领域,大多数政务知识以1X1文档、职0乂文档、 從1报表、取士页面等形式存放。这些类型的文件容量一般不是很大。通过该系统对上述文件进行023加密或解密操作,可在数秒内迅速完成。当然,也有些政务知识以图像、音频甚至视频等形式存放。这类文件的容量要大一些,相应的06:3加密和解密过程也要耗费更多的时间。不过,总体而言,与其他相对安全的加密技术相比较,其运行效率还是相对高的。
主界面 ⑶系统版权说明界面
图6-14加密系统2111025
219065系统操作简单,图6-15和图6-16分别描述了对政务知识实施063加密和解密的系统操作流程。其中,加密流程中的密码有效性检测则通过检査密码长度(不能小于8个字节,多余8个字节部分将被系统忽略但不报错〉以及两次输人是否相同等机制实现。解密流程中的密码有效性检测仅检查所输人的密码长度是否小于8位,当长度不足时及时报错并给出相应提示信息。
一方面, 11025并没有像2191015提取流程那样,在01;5解密阶段实施密码比对判断以及限制测试次数以防止穷举攻击。其原因在于,21111018在嵌入机密知识的同时把嵌人密码也同步嵌人掩护图像了,这为知识提取阶段的密码比对奠定了基础。另一方面,对于基于158的图像隐藏算法,其提取过程本身并不需要密码参与,只是对图像数据区相关1 58位平面上的数据直接读取或与原图相关数据做“异或”运算即可。此种情况下,实施密码比对以控制提取活动的合法性十分必要。
(未完待续) 声明:部分资料来自合作媒体及网络,不代表本站观点。关键字:加密,密码,系统,解密,政务